<h3 id="understanding-registered-agents" id="understanding-registered-agents">Understanding Registered Agents</h3>

<p>A registered agent is an person or organization designated to handle official papers and state correspondence on in representation of a company. This can comprise process serving, fiscal notices, and additional important documents from the state. Having a reliable registered agent is vital for maintaining conformity with state regulations and guaranteeing that critical documents are managed swiftly.</p>

<p>In Washington, a registered agent must be a local of the state or a corporation authorized to engage in business there. This condition helps certify that there is a consistent point of communication for legal issues. <h3 id="faqs-about-washington-registered-agent" id="faqs-about-washington-registered-agent">FAQs About Washington Registered Agent</h3>

<p>Selecting a registered agent in WA is essential for any company owner. One frequent inquiry is, what exactly does a designated agent do? A registered agent serves as a connection between your company and the state. They receive critical legal documents, such as legal summons and regulatory notices, ensuring your company stays updated and in compliance with state regulations.</p>

<p>Another often asked question involves the criteria for becoming a designated agent in WA. To qualify, the agent must be a inhabitant of WA or a business entity authorized to conduct business in the region. They must also have a street address in Washington, as P.O. mailboxes are not permitted. This guarantees that the designated agent is available for receiving government correspondence.</p>
